Learn about CVE-2021-31854, a code injection vulnerability in McAfee Agent for Windows that allows local users to inject arbitrary shell code, potentially leading to privilege escalation.
A command injection vulnerability in McAfee Agent (MA) for Windows before version 5.7.5 allows local users to inject arbitrary shell code into the file cleanup.exe, potentially leading to privilege escalation and obtaining root privileges.
Understanding CVE-2021-31854
This CVE identifier points to a code injection vulnerability in McAfee Agent for Windows that could be exploited by local users for malicious activities.
What is CVE-2021-31854?
CVE-2021-31854 refers to a vulnerability in McAfee Agent for Windows that allows unauthorized local users to inject malicious shell code into specific files, enabling them to execute arbitrary commands and potentially escalate their privileges.
The Impact of CVE-2021-31854
The impact of this vulnerability is rated as high, with a CVSS base score of 7.7. It poses a significant risk to affected systems' confidentiality, integrity, and availability, potentially leading to unauthorized access and control.
Technical Details of CVE-2021-31854
Below are the technical details associated with the CVE-2021-31854 vulnerability:
Vulnerability Description
The vulnerability allows local users to inject arbitrary shell code into the file cleanup.exe, potentially granting them elevated privileges.
Affected Systems and Versions
Exploitation Mechanism
Exploiting this vulnerability involves placing a malicious clean.exe file in a specific folder and running the McAfee Agent deployment feature found in the System Tree. This action enables attackers to execute arbitrary commands.
Mitigation and Prevention
To address the CVE-2021-31854 vulnerability and enhance system security, the following measures are recommended:
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Regularly apply security patches and updates to all software components, including McAfee Agent, to prevent exploitation of known vulnerabilities.